Transaction f31ed8923016ab0c1d6c9c6646f4f9f4187091af59e18b7a28616106c3663a64
1 Input
1 Output
-
f31ed8923016ab0c1d6c9c6646f4f9f4187091af59e18b7a28616106c3663a64:0
- value
- 27350
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 10aa128be8f2ef14b0e40e3880e2839555335023 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12X7YunYuX8NXL93h3rdDny3kn9reuhpJh